EU, Commonwealth accused of hiding Pakistan election rigging

By Abida Kahlun


SNN News Finland

🇵🇰 The European Union and the Commonwealth have come under sharp criticism after being accused of colluding with Pakistan’s military

backed government to cover up alleged widespread election rigging.

According to opposition voices and rights groups, international observers failed to highlight serious

irregularities during Pakistan’s recent elections, instead issuing statements that downplayed the scale of alleged manipulation.

Critics argue that this silence has effectively provided legitimacy to the ruling setup,

raising concerns over transparency, democratic accountability, and the credibility of international monitoring missions.

Calls are now growing for independent investigations to determine

the extent of election rigging and the role of international bodies in shaping global perceptions of Pakistan’s democratic process.
